Cassis: Clos Sainte Magdeleine Rosé 2011

As well as the Clos Sainte Magdeleine blanc, François Sack’s estate also makes a spot of pretty, coral-pink Cassis rosé from Provençal staples Grenache, Cinsault and Mourvèdre. It has delicate red–berry aromas and a savoury, dry finish and it too has a definite affinity for seafood – lobster, langoustines or a simple dressed crab would suffice.
